Output ff97d3bfdfe1eff1cd2f6163ceb01135e80d5ed48b13bedd52bee3c120f02b97:674

value
23748755446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 309b62a8e0312f4c752275c6ef4e3c66c0c031d5 OP_EQUALVERIFY OP_CHECKSIG
address
D9a77qEXZG4sdPTsM17KvwrmLM1fDRGY7D
transaction
ff97d3bfdfe1eff1cd2f6163ceb01135e80d5ed48b13bedd52bee3c120f02b97